ENGL 10C: Literatures in English, 1850 to Present Prof. BanShi Question: Compare the representation of war in literature from the early to mid-20th century. How do different authors depict the human experience of conflict? Response: The depiction of war in literature varies across different periods, with works like Erich Maria Remarque's "All Quiet on the Western Front" offering a gritty portrayal of the human experience during World War I. How do authors use the theme of nostalgia to explore memory, identity, and the passage of time? Response: Nostalgia serves as a poignant theme in contemporary literature, as illustrated in Kazuo Ishiguro's "The Buried Giant." The novel weaves elements of nostalgia into its exploration of memory, identity, and the consequences of forgetting, inviting readers to reflect on the complex interplay between past and present.
